Jeera water

Jeera water has 14.5 calories per serving (1 Glass) — that's 5.9 calories per 100g. It provides 0.7g protein, 1.1g carbs, and 0.8g fat. With a low glycemic index (GI: 55), this recipe is suitable for diabetes management, heart health. It contains anti-inflammatory ingredients like turmeric and ginger.

Cooking time: 10 minutes

Serves: 1 persons

Ingredients

Water
240 Milliliter
Cumin powder
1 Tea Spoon

Instructions

1
Warm the water
In a vessel, pour water, put it on a stove let it boil for 2 minutes so that it is warm.
2
Mix cumin powder
Pour this water into a glass, add 1/2- 1 teaspoon of cumin powder and consume it.
